The owner of a Rs 120 crore penthouse in Mumbai has turned down multiple offers from Bollywood stars, emphasizing that the property is not for sale to just anyone. 'We need to ensure that the buyer is the right person,' Agarwal stated.
Mumbai Real EstateLuxury PenthouseHighend PropertyAgarwal PropertiesCelebrity BuyersReal Estate MumbaiNov 15, 2024
The penthouse is currently valued at Rs 120 crore.
The owner, Mr. Agarwal, believes that the property is more than just a monetary asset and wants to ensure that the buyer is the right person to appreciate and respect its value.
The penthouse spans over 10,000 square feet and includes a private gym, a home theater, and a sprawling terrace with breathtaking views of the Arabian Sea.
